About This Video

In this video I break down five time-saving marketing hacks that actually work for dog trainers—even if you “suck at tech.” The whole point is simple: stop spending hours on random marketing and start using a system that gets you booked consistently without living behind a desk. I walk you through the exact flow I use: a pre-built funnel template (so you’re not reinventing the wheel), automated follow-ups (so you stop losing the 80% of leads that don’t buy on the first touch), and a booking calendar (so you eliminate the annoying back-and-forth and don’t need a VA just to schedule calls). Then I talk ads, but not the way most people teach it. I’m not telling you to throw money at cold audiences and hope. My favorite “secret” is retargeting: only run ads to people who already watched your stuff or engaged with your posts. Finally, I show how to capture leads from social media with a freebie funnel—give them a lead magnet, overdeliver, then invite them to book a call and apply. When this is set up, you focus on two things: making good content and servicing clients.
